My husband and I went to have Mother’s Day brunch at the Oakdale Hy Vee restaurant this morning This was definitely the worst buffet brunch I have ever had. First- it was $50 for the 2 of us. We were given a nasty orange drink instead of real orange juice - and she only filled the small glasses a little over half full. The buffet was extremely lacking: biscuits and watered down sausage gravy, soupy cheesy potatoes with onion and bacon bits, greasy soggy bacon, sausage links, extremely dry AND cold FAKE scrambled eggs with hard melted cheese on top, a small bowl of assorted fruit, croissants, small apple pastries, donut holes, ham and over cooked prime rib. No muffins, toast, bagels, English muffins, pancakes or french toast. I’ve had better FREE continental breakfasts (with more variety) at hotels I’ve stayed at. Then, we get to the booth that has a sign on the table saying that it’s been sanitized for our safety. There was food on the napkin holder, on the wall, on the seat, and smeared all over the back of the booth. (I have pics). We asked three different staff members for silverware - and were told by each that they would get us some, but no one ever brought us any silverware. We ended up grabbing some plastic utensils. Please note: these people were NOT busy. There were only 2 other tables with customers in the restaurant. We left without finishing even one plate of food. My husband went back to grab some more of the spiral ham (it was really the only thing that wasn’t half bad). He stood there waiting for over 5 minutes, but the employee who was supposed to be there carving the meat did not return - so we just left. All in all: I would definitely NOT recommend Oakdale Hy Vee Mother’s Day Brunch. Ridiculously high price for the lack of variety and poor quality of food - not to mention, the utterly horrible service. If we thought they would have given us our money back, we would have asked. Needless to say - we won’t be returning. Just incredibly disappointed.
